[35], Markie guest starred in the SpongeBob SquarePants episode "Kenny the Cat" in the episode's title role. [15], For the remainder of the decade, Markie occasionally made television appearances, including guest appearances on In Living Color; as contestant Damian "Foosball" Franklin in the recurring game show sketch "The Dirty Dozens"; as Marlon Cain in "Ed Bacon: Guidance Counselor";[18] in a 1996 freestyle rap commercial on MTV2; and in the 1993 superhero film Meteor Man. [26], In 2002, Markie appeared in Men in Black II, with Will Smith and Tommy Lee Jones, playing an alien parody of himself, whose native language sounded exactly like beatboxing. [7][8] He was raised on Long Island in the hamlet of Brentwood[6][9] and the village of Patchogue, where he spent his teenage years and where, on September 25, 2021, the intersection of South Street and West Avenue, across the street from his then-home, was dedicated as Biz Markie Way. Born in Harlem in 1964 and raised on Long Island, Biz made his debut on Roxanne Shantes 1986 single The Def Fresh Crew, billed as the Inhuman Orchestra, doing his beatbox version of the Meow Mix cat-food jingle.
